SS2-r – Safe Stop 2 with monitoring of the deceleration ramp

When the SS2-r safety subfunction is active, the motor is brought to a standstill electrically. The deceleration is monitored. The position must be safely monitored after standstill (SOS function according to EN 61800‑5‑2). The STO safety subfunction will be triggered if the deceleration value is exceeded while stopping or movement occurs in an idle state. After the STO safety subfunction has been triggered, the idle state has to be ensured, for example, by a mechanical brake.

The SS2-r safety subfunction corresponds to a controlled stop of the drive according to EN 60204‑1, stop category 2.
